Open-air reconstructed Norman motte-and-bailey castle with period village scenes and roaming animals; one of the village’s signature heritage attractions.
Large toy museum beside the castle, known for extensive displays of dolls, model railways, games, and vintage childhood memorabilia.
Important modern art destination in nearby Perry Green with sculpture displays and landscaped grounds associated with Henry Moore’s work.
National Trust-managed ancient royal hunting forest with lakes, woodland walks, and photogenic open landscapes close to the village and airport.
One of the village’s characteristic streets, lined with historic buildings and useful for experiencing Stansted Mountfitchet’s traditional settlement character.
Privately owned gardens nearby, known for seasonal planting, landscaped grounds, and visual appeal among garden lovers and social-media visitors.
Traditional pork sausages associated with Essex, often served with mash or in a breakfast. They are a familiar regional comfort food.
A classic dish in South East England of savory meat pie with mashed potatoes, often served with parsley liquor. It is a long-standing local staple.
A historic dish from the wider London and Thames estuary area, made by cooking eels and setting the broth into a jelly. It is a traditional regional specialty.

Costs are moderate by UK standards. Airport-area food and transport can be pricier than nearby towns.
Service is often included at restaurants; if not, 10-12.5% is usual for good service. Round up taxis. Tipping in pubs and cafes is optional, not expected.
